To really appreciate the crucial function of a Level 2 electrician, it's important to understand the scope of their work. Unlike a basic electrician who mainly deals with internal circuitry within a structure, a Level 2 expert is licensed to work on the service mains. This includes whatever from the power pole or underground pit right up to the service fuse website and meter box on a facility. This incorporates a broad range of jobs that are important for both new connections and maintaining existing ones.

Consider the scenario of a freshly developed home. Before the lights can even flicker on, a Level 2 electrician is needed. They are accountable for establishing the service connection, installing the service main cable, and ensuring it's safely and properly connected to the network's point of supply. This involves browsing complex regulations and adhering to strict safety procedures, as they are dealing with high-voltage electrical power directly from the grid. Their work ensures that when the power is turned on, it flows securely and dependably to the residential or commercial property.

But their duties extend far beyond initial connections. Picture a storm has actually swept through, bringing down power lines and triggering extensive blackouts. While the major power companies work on the bigger network, Level 2 electricians are typically on the cutting edge, resolving specific home damage. They are authorized to repair damaged service mains, replace faulty power poles, and re-establish connections that have been interfered with. Their swift and specialist intervention is often the secret to restoring power to homes and organizations, reducing disturbance and guaranteeing neighborhood safety.

Furthermore, these experts play an important role in updating electrical infrastructure. As our energy needs develop, with the increasing adoption of solar panels, electrical vehicle charging stations, and other high-demand home appliances, existing service mains may need to be upgraded to accommodate the increased load. A Level 2 electrician examines the current capacity, determines the required upgrades, and expertly installs larger cable televisions or modifies existing connections to ensure the residential or commercial property can handle the brand-new power needs without danger of overload or fire.

Their competence likewise encompasses more nuanced situations, such as handling short-lived power materials for construction websites or events. They are accountable for establishing and dismantling these connections, guaranteeing they satisfy all safety standards and are capable of handling the short-term load. This meticulous preparation and execution avoid accidents and guarantee constant power for vital operations.
